Crossover clamps ordered. These are the Torcite stainless step clamps for the crossover.
These are some of the best clamps you can buy for such an application. T-304 stainless.

Step clamps solve the issue where SD headers come with inferior style C clamps.
They ensure no leakage at the crossover connections.
